Can a healthy lifestyle reprogram sperm? new study investigates.
NCT ID NCT04175678
First seen Mar 16, 2026 · Last updated May 19, 2026 · Updated 11 times
Summary
This study looks at whether diet and exercise can improve the genetic markers in sperm of overweight, inactive Hispanic men. Researchers will compare sperm samples from 100 men before and after a 12-week program of diet changes, exercise, or both. The goal is to see if lifestyle changes can create healthier sperm that may pass on better health to future children.
